We usually always eat at the same places, but this time we thought we would try somewhere new. First the good...the portion size was large, definitely won't be left hungry. We had to get it to go and we ate in the car. We have a 4 month old that gets very moody very fast, so we stick to on the go foods. It came with a small salad and was supposed to come with a soup but I guess you don't get the soup unless you eat inside. I do not like the fact that you are supposed to eat shrimp sauce as "dressing" for the salad. I would really prefer ranch or thousand island or really anything else. We are from North Carolina towards Asheville so I had brought a small cooler of drinks. Thank god I did because we both got the chicken and thin sliced steak and it was VERY salty. We both probably ate about half and in that amount of time we had literally chugged 2 cans of drinks each and working on a third can. I also don't think I am a fan of their fried rice either..its not sticky rice that most places use, it's basic white rice just with the salty sauce they put on everything and reminds be of the packaged rice a roni products, and most places the fried rice has at least carrots and peas and onions in it and this literally has nothing. The meat was also supposed to come with onion, zucchini, and mushroom and all that was in both mine and my boyfriends was onions...so that was disappointing. The people working seemed really nice and friendly, I just probably won't be back because when I say salty..I honestly mean....SALTY..it's a shame all they have is like the 5 teriyaki meals n that's it..im a hibachi fan myself, but when I think of teriyaki I think sweet..not salty to where I need drink the next 3...

The portion sizes are good, the food is okay, and the service and atmosphere really leave a lot to be desired. I had the sesame chicken and it was pretty good. The onion soup was practically undrinkable between the saltiness and the flavor/smell of dish soap in the bowl. Service was run ragged, clearly focused on bigger tables, and I was never offered a refill or checked on besides having my order taken and food brought to me. The ambience inside is terrible. Dark, dingy, terrible echo, and tight quarters. The smell of whatever they clean the tables with also practically overwhelms the food smell at times and while I appreciate effort into cleanliness, the smell was very off-putting. While I might be back for the food, I'd be doing a pick up order instead of dining in.

Fantastic Japanese restaurant! We go every time we're in town to visit my wife's family. The lunch specials are great and always make for two meals with leftovers. I got the sesame chicken and Yakiniku (beef) for my Moto Combo. The lunch specials come with salad (either shrimp or ginger dressing), soup, and sides of carrots (sweet carrot slices, reminds me of being a kid), mushrooms, and a big bed of brown rice. Totally a great value! They're offering dine in, takeout, drive thru, and curbside pickup right now as well. Try it!!
